Description
(10S,11S)-dihydroxy-10,11-dihydrocarbamazepine is the (10S,11S)-enantiomer of 10,11-trans-dihydroxy-10,11-dihydrocarbamazepine. It is an enantiomer of a (10R,11R)-dihydroxy-10,11-dihydrocarbamazepine.
Drug Information
Carbamazepine-10,11-dihydro-10,11-dihydroxy is a known transformation product of Carbamazepine.
